Watch live Heraklion Port, from the capital of the Greek island of Crete, Heraklion. Here you see a wonderful stretch of the seaside of the city, situated on the northern coast of the island, on the Aegean Sea. This streaming shows you an overview of Heraklion Port, a main street in the foreground, and on the left-hand side of the image you have a glimpse of the Venetian Koules Fortress (Fortress Rocca al Mare), built in 16th century.
In the port city of Heraklion you will find the significant archaeological site of Knossos, from the Minoan civilisation (about 2600 to 1600 BC). The island of Crete is the largest of the Greek islands, an important tourist destination for its history, culture, and archaeological sites. It is also known for its beautiful, mountainous landscapes.
